
I've mentioned before that, I wholeheartedly believe a healthy life doesn't go without the spiritual element. God designed it that way. He created our physical bodies and they are a gift to us. Taking care of these gifts (as any other) should be an extension of our worship to Him. But, even if we do believe this, sometimes our own minds get in the way. If this weren't true then we wouldn't be seeing Meme's all over our social media feed motivating us to workout and eat healthy, right!?! Are these messages encouraging us in the right ways? As my walk with the Lord has deepened I have often wondered if some of these messages were actually motivating me in the right perspective. This brings in a third element, healthy minds. I found that creating an atmosphere where Christ was glorified was more important than elevating ourselves to accomplish a goal. When we are motivating ourselves with messages that WE CAN DO IT, or WE ARE STRONG are we missing what GOD can do in us?
Monday I shared this verse from Psalm 37:4, I'm going to share it again because it applies here to.
" Delight yourself also in the Lord,
And He shall give you the desires of your heart." Psalm 37:4
There have been a few times I have had a plan to compete again or set a new goal in my fitness journey that has changed midstream because my desires had changed. Here, is often the reason why. If I focus mainly on the "goal" first, I risk making that goal an idol, elevating it or myself above God. Filling my mind with truth is important in the process of creating a healthy life. It's really quite profound!
I'm certainly not saying that all the meme's are bad for motivation, what I am saying is that creating a healthy mind should be based on the truth! Again, we continuously have to be reminded of the truth keeping each other accountable because our minds are so easily corrupted by Satan's lies. Satan is the master of deception, always twisting and manipulating, targeting our weaknesses. A simple message intended to encourage and empower us can be used by Satan to lure us into discontent, contentiousness, selfish ambition, jealousy, and self-empowerment. I know, I've been there many times. I have surrounded myself in the fitness culture where the "do whatever it takes to reach your goal" mentality has left me unsettled. Friends, this is not truth! Truth, God's word says:
Matthew 6:25-34
25 “Therefore I say to you, do not worry about your life, what you will eat or what you will drink; nor about your body, what you will put on. Is not life more than food and the body more than clothing? 26 Look at the birds of the air, for they neither sow nor reap nor gather into barns; yet your heavenly Father feeds them. Are you not of more value than they?27 Which of you by worrying can add one cubit to his stature?
28 “So why do you worry about clothing? Consider the lilies of the field, how they grow: they neither toil nor spin; 29 and yet I say to you that even Solomon in all his glory was not arrayed like one of these. 30 Now if God so clothes the grass of the field, which today is, and tomorrow is thrown into the oven, will He not much more clothe you, O you of little faith?
31 “Therefore do not worry, saying, ‘What shall we eat?’ or ‘What shall we drink?’ or ‘What shall we wear?’ 32 For after all these things the Gentiles seek. For your heavenly Father knows that you need all these things.33 But seek first the kingdom of God and His righteousness, and all these things shall be added to you. 34 Therefore do not worry about tomorrow, for tomorrow will worry about its own things. Sufficient for the day is its own trouble.
